Alan Shearer shared that he wished he was able to put more Newcastle United players in his Team of the Weeks after a fan asked him about the lack of representation the club had in his teams currently.

The Magpies legend issued the three-word responses after sharing his latest Premier League Team of the Week on his Instagram, which contained no members of Rafa Benitez’s squad despite their decent performance against Manchester United on Saturday.

Shearer’s Team of the Week instead featured two Wolves players, two Manchester City players, three Chelsea players, one Bournemouth player, one Arsenal player, one Manchester United player and one Everton player.
